It’s located in the heart of St Bees - one of West Cumbria’s most sought-after villages.
The independent St Bees School is just round the corner and St Bees Village Primary (rated “Good” by Ofsted) is in the main village, a pleasant 15 minute walk away.
Older kids are within the catchment for the popular West Lakes Academy in Egremont, which is around 10 minutes drive away.
Whilst there is a post office and village store in St Bees, it’s likely you’ll head to Egremont for your day-to-day needs. The town has everything you’d want, with a range of local shops and an active local community.
Having said that, Whitehaven is only 15 minutes away in the car, where you’ll find all the bigger name stores, restaurants and takeaways.
And there’s no need to always take the car.
The beach is less than a 15 minute walk away and if you’re heading further afield St Bees has its own station, which is only a 5 minute walk away. There are regular trains to Whitehaven, Barrow and Carlisle, where you can connect to the wider UK rail network.
